Step 1
From the position of beryllium, Be, in the periodic table, beryllium is most likely to be a

Answer
Beryllium (Be) is located in the second group and second period of the periodic table, which categorizes it as a metal. Therefore, the correct answer is A. metal.
Step 2
Give the symbol of the element that is in period 2 and in group 3.

Answer
The element in period 2 and group 3 is boron. Thus, the symbol is B.
Step 3
State the number of electron shells in an atom of potassium, K.

Answer
Potassium (K) is located in period 4 of the periodic table, which indicates that it has 4 electron shells.
